Media-X Prototype Grant is calling for application!

  • Supports media innovations to solve business, social or community problems in Asia-Pacific
  • Awards up to HK$150,000 and resources support including entrepreneurship training


Media-X Prototype Grant Scheme is a pilot funding initiative launched by the Journalism and Media Studies Centre (JMSC) of The University of Hong Kong. It aims to work with Asia-Pacific Innovators in developing media solutions to business, social or community problems in a commercially sustainable way.

The initiative is guided by an advisory board chaired by Ruby Yang, an Oscar-winning documentarian and professor at the JMSC, and co-ordinated by Ross Settles, a media business veteran and professor at the JMSC. The Xu Family Charitable Foundation, the family fund of Dr. Eric Xu Yong - co-founder of Baidu, is the contributor for Media X.

Eligibility:

Media Innovators in Asia-Pacific who fulfil the following conditions:

  • Are located in the following country/regions: Greater China including Hong Kong, Macao, Taiwan, Indonesia, Japan, Korea, Malaysia, Mongolia, Philippines, Singapore, and Thailand.
  • Apply as a team of 1-3 members. (A minimum of 2 team members is recommended)

Grant Amount:

Up to a maximum amount of HK$150,000 per award team/project.

Grantees from the scheme will benefit from different services and resource support including entrepreneurship training, use of work spaces at the JMSC, and funding support for developing media solutions.

Application is open from now until 15 May 2020.
